M.C.B. to Harriet Anna Yancey, February 21,
|
Index Terms:Place--International | Travel Notes About This Letter This is a postcard. A picture of a Mango tree on front along with the words: "Greetings From Jamaica" and "Mango Tree, Bearing
Fruit."
Summary:
Postcard of greetings to Harriet Yancey.
Letterhead:
Envelope:
To: Mrs Harriet Yancy 972 Woodland Ave. Plainfield New Jersey U.S.A. Postmark: ?Street Letter?
Transcription of Letter
Feb 21st-
Dear Harriet-
Have only three more weeks here and the weather is so ?bad?. Its trying. The Duke & Duchess are in Montigo Bay will tell you about them.
M.C.B.
